Commercial Slab Construction in Kalamazoo, MI
Commercial slab construction services involve the preparation and pouring of concrete foundations for various types of commercial projects, such as retail stores, warehouses, office buildings, and industrial facilities. These services typically include site assessment, excavation, formwork, reinforcement, and finishing to create a durable, level surface that supports the structure’s weight and usage. Property owners usually want to understand the scope of the work, the materials used, and the importance of proper preparation to ensure the longevity and stability of their commercial building.
Before requesting commercial slab construction, property owners should consider factors such as the size and design of the project, soil conditions, and any specific load requirements. It’s also helpful to inquire about the permitting process and how the project will be coordinated with other construction phases. Clear communication about these details can help ensure the foundation is built to meet the needs of the building and withstand local environmental conditions.

Commercial Slab Construction Questions
What types of projects require a commercial slab? Commercial slabs are commonly used for building foundations, parking areas, driveways, and loading docks on business properties in Kalamazoo and nearby areas.
How thick should a commercial slab be? The thickness of a commercial slab varies based on its intended use, typically ranging from 4 to 12 inches for most applications.
What materials are used in commercial slab construction? Reinforced concrete is the standard material, often combined with steel rebar or mesh to enhance strength and durability.
What should property owners consider before construction? Proper site preparation, soil stability, and load requirements are important factors to ensure a long-lasting and functional slab.
